Summary

The investigators are testing two digital health interventions for trichotillomania (TTM), via a randomized trial design.

Conditions

  • Trichotillomania

Interventions

DEVICE

Keen2 bracelet

Participants will receive an awareness bracelet (Keen2) which vibrates upon detection of hair pulling motion, supporting behavior therapy for hair pulling delivered by the Keen2 app.

DEVICE

Reminder bracelet

Participants will receive a non-vibrating bracelet to wear as a visual reminder not to pull.

BEHAVIORAL

Keen2 app

Participants will be given access to a smartphone app. The bracelet and app work together to implement key features of habit reversal training for TTM, including psychoeducation, awareness training, competing response training, and personalized just-in-time stimulus control and other behavioral strategy reminders.

BEHAVIORAL

Health Reminders App

Participants will be given access to a smartphone app that will prompt them to log their context (e.g., location and activity) throughout the day and provide general health tips.
